Nine Excellent Charlestown Restaurants That Deliver

"Sweet Rice, which serves a mix of Thai and Japanese food, is currently delivering and offering takeout from both locations (Charlestown and Jamaica Plain). Can’t decide whether you’re in the mood for a sushi boat or khao soi? No problem; Sweet Rice has both. Order: Official Site" - Terrence Doyle

Decided to venture out of Boston and into Charlestown for sushi. EXCEEDED expectations! Not just sushi, Sweet Rice has both Japanese and Thai cuisine so if you're feeling torn as I always do you don't even need to make the choice. Okay so honestly, every thing was great. Really, can't go wrong from the salmon rolls to varieties of fried rice and pad thai. Now with that said there was one unexpected star of the order. Admittedly I ordered it almost solely for the name alongside several other rolls. But THE SPONGEBOB was everything. If I remember correctly it is Shrimp Tempura, cream cheese, and cucumber wrapped with rice and topped with MANGO Fresh Mango! And I think the real secret is the honey coconut sauce, very interesting, unexpected, but exceptional. So all I'm saying is order what you normally would but don't forget 'The Spongebob'!

We've eaten at Sweet Rice quite a few times over the years and have done take out from there as well. Last night (Saturday) we dined in with a group of four people to try new dishes (and some old favorites). The food was, as always, outstanding, and the service was wonderful. This is a true family business and it shows in the care given to every aspect of the meal. We love their duck dishes, have had all three many times now. Our favorite is probably the roasted duck due primarily to the luscious spicy hoisin sauce which comes with it). Eggplant and bok choy dishes are always excellent as well. Last night we also tried the sushi/sashimi platter (for the first time) and were very impressed with the quality of the fish as well as the presentation. They have some wonderful appetizers (the Hae Kainge and the Shrimp Nime Chow are two of our favorites, though we had bone-in spareribs, shrimp rolls, and steamed pork dumplings last night to try something new and were very impressed by the flavors) to start the meal and their array of mixed drinks has something for every taste. They also make a perfectly balanced Thai iced tea. There are so many dishes we have yet to explore and are looking forward to doing so.
